Manufacturing - Machine Operator

Help us build quality products that people love as a Machine Operatorin Randolph, VTat Hearth & Home Technologies. This rewarding career includes competitive compensation, comprehensive benefits and a supportive environment focused on developing your skills.

Our Machine Operators are responsible for set up and operation of various machines to construct Hearth & Home Technologies' industry-leading fireplaces, stoves and hearth products. You'll be performing basic machine set up, load/unload, and manufacture of programmed parts including the disassembly and assembly of machines, and maximize efficiencies in changeover necessary regarding tools, equipment, jigs, carts, etc. The ability to complete finished product within the parameters outlined in blueprints, mini-bills, and/or schedule along with adherence to all quality standards by producing products which align with the print specifications is critical to this position.

Hearth & Home Technologies believes in the power of Lean Manufacturing. Our production environments emphasize flow and continuous improvement efforts. Our Machine Operators work within a team-driven environment to assemble quality products and improve our efficiencies.

Hearth & Home Technologies is an operating division of HNI Corporation (NYSE: HNI). We design, manufacture and distribute a wide variety of gas, electric, wood and biomass burning fireplaces, inserts, stoves and accessories. All in the USA.Lakeville, Minnesota is our home, but we have locations throughout the United States.
